The first one is related to the violence of a fundamental requirement to the notion of state (thermodynamical) variable, namely: a state variable is defined provided it is insensitive to the particularities of the spatio-temporal configurations upon which the averaging over the dynamical variables proceeds. The second one is related to a ubiquitous divergence of the scattering length in the low-energy limit. In turn, it makes the rates of all the elementary processes divergent as well.
